.featured{display:grid;grid-template-columns:1.05fr .95fr;gap:46px;align-items:center;padding:50px 0 56px}.featured h1{font-family:var(--font-display);font-weight:800;font-size:clamp(34px,4.6vw,58px);line-height:1;letter-spacing:-.03em;margin:0 0 22px;text-wrap:balance}[data-skin=atlasz] .featured h1{font-weight:700;letter-spacing:-.02em}.featured .dek{font-size:17px;line-height:1.62;color:var(--ink);opacity:.82;margin:0 0 26px;max-width:42ch}.home-sectionhead{margin-top:6px}[data-skin=tiszta] .home-sectionhead{border-top-color:var(--ink)}.mapsection{padding:64px 0 30px}.maphead{display:flex;align-items:flex-end;justify-content:space-between;gap:26px;flex-wrap:wrap;margin-bottom:24px}.maphead h2{font-family:var(--font-display);font-weight:800;font-size:clamp(26px,3.4vw,40px);letter-spacing:-.025em;margin:0;max-width:20ch}[data-skin=atlasz] .maphead h2{font-weight:700}.maphead h2 em{font-style:normal;color:var(--accent)}.maphead p{font-size:14px;color:var(--muted);max-width:34ch;margin:0;text-align:right;line-height:1.5}.heat{position:relative;display:block;height:400px;background:var(--surface);border:1px solid var(--line);border-radius:var(--radius);overflow:hidden}.graticule{position:absolute;inset:0;background-image:radial-gradient(circle,var(--muted) .9px,transparent 1px);background-size:24px 24px;opacity:.28;-webkit-mask-image:radial-gradient(ellipse 72% 86% at 50% 48%,#000 52%,transparent 100%);mask-image:radial-gradient(ellipse 72% 86% at 50% 48%,#000 52%,transparent 100%)}.bloom{position:absolute;border-radius:50%;transform:translate(-50%,-50%);pointer-events:none;background:radial-gradient(circle,var(--accent) 0%,transparent 68%);filter:blur(7px)}.hotspot{position:absolute;transform:translate(-50%,-50%);display:flex;flex-direction:column;align-items:center;gap:7px}.hotspot .ring{display:flex;align-items:center;justify-content:center;border-radius:50%;border:1.5px solid var(--accent);background:color-mix(in oklab,var(--accent) 22%,transparent);font-family:var(--font-mono);font-weight:600;color:var(--ink)}.hotspot .nm{font-family:var(--font-mono);font-size:11px;color:var(--ink);background:color-mix(in oklab,var(--surface) 65%,transparent);padding:2px 7px;border-radius:5px;white-space:nowrap}.legend{position:absolute;left:18px;bottom:16px;display:flex;align-items:center;gap:10px;font-family:var(--font-mono);font-size:11px;color:var(--muted)}.legend .ramp{width:120px;height:8px;border-radius:5px;background:linear-gradient(90deg,color-mix(in oklab,var(--accent) 12%,transparent),var(--accent))}.mapnote{position:absolute;right:18px;bottom:16px;font-family:var(--font-mono);font-size:10px;letter-spacing:.12em;text-transform:uppercase;color:var(--muted)}.regions{display:flex;gap:10px;flex-wrap:wrap;padding:22px 0 0}.region{border:1px solid var(--line);background:var(--surface);border-radius:999px;padding:9px 16px;font-family:var(--font-mono);font-size:12px;color:var(--ink);display:flex;align-items:center;gap:8px}.region:hover{border-color:var(--accent)}.region b{color:var(--muted);font-weight:500}@media(max-width:880px){.featured{grid-template-columns:1fr}.maphead p{text-align:left}}.trips-head{display:flex;align-items:baseline;justify-content:space-between;gap:16px;margin:6px 0 26px}.trips-head h1{font-family:var(--font-display);font-weight:700;font-size:clamp(26px,3vw,42px);line-height:1;margin:0}.trips-head .more,.triphead .more{font-family:var(--font-mono);font-size:11px;letter-spacing:.06em;text-transform:uppercase;color:var(--muted);white-space:nowrap}.trips-head .more:hover,.triphead .more:hover{color:var(--accent)}.trip{margin:0 0 30px}.triphead{display:flex;align-items:baseline;justify-content:space-between;gap:14px;margin:0 0 12px;padding-top:16px;border-top:1px solid var(--line)}.triphead h2{font-family:var(--font-display);font-weight:700;font-size:22px;margin:0}.triprow{display:grid;grid-template-columns:var(--tc, 1.7fr 1fr 1fr 1fr);gap:10px}.triprow .cell{position:relative;display:block;overflow:hidden;border-radius:var(--radius-sm);text-decoration:none;background:color-mix(in srgb,var(--ink) 8%,transparent)}.triprow .cell img{width:100%;height:100%;object-fit:cover;display:block;transition:transform .5s ease}.triprow .cell:hover img{transform:scale(1.05)}.triprow .lead{aspect-ratio:1.7 / 1}.triprow .thumb{aspect-ratio:1 / 1}.triprow .lead .cap{position:absolute;inset:auto 0 0;padding:20px 18px 15px;background:linear-gradient(to top,rgba(0,0,0,.74),rgba(0,0,0,.1) 60%,transparent);color:#fff;font-family:var(--font-display);font-weight:700;font-size:clamp(17px,1.7vw,24px);line-height:1.1}.triprow .thumb .cap{position:absolute;inset:auto 0 0;padding:26px 10px 9px;background:linear-gradient(to top,rgba(0,0,0,.72),transparent);color:#fff;font-size:12px;font-weight:600;line-height:1.2;opacity:0;transition:opacity .25s ease}.triprow .thumb:hover .cap{opacity:1}@media(max-width:720px){.triprow{grid-template-columns:1fr 1fr}.triprow .lead{grid-column:1 / 3;aspect-ratio:16 / 10}.triprow .thumb{aspect-ratio:1 / 1}.triprow .thumb .cap{opacity:1}}
